The new Tork Elevation washroom dispensers, launched in January 2009, have been awarded the prestigious red dot award. With more than 11,000 submissions from 61 countries, this is the largest and most renowned international design competition in the world.
Red dot is an international prize for excellent product design, awarded yearly by Design Zentrum Nordrhein Westfalen in Essen, Germany.
“Receiving this award – on top of the iF product design award 2009 that Tork Elevation received earlier this year – means that the new line already has received the two most prestigious design prizes in this category, which of course is great,” says Karin Öjersjö, Category Product Manager.
Functional and aesthetic design
The Tork Elevation-range is designed for ease of day-to-day maintenance whilst at the same time making the washroom experience more pleasant. Functional design in hygiene areas is the starting point when developing Tork products.
A dispenser must be user friendly, both for maintenance personnel and washroom visitors. It also needs to be aesthetically appealing.
“We have a long-term commitment to develop functional design together with the best designers. Combining designer skills with our own costumer insights and knowledge is a way of working that repeatedly results in positive feedback from our customers,” says Karin Öjersjö.
